Scale model kit REVELL Starter Kit - Bismarck (ship model starter set)
REVELL Starter Kit - Bismarck (ship model starter set) provides the essential components for beginners to assemble a scale model of the Bismarck battleship. The set includes pre-molded parts and basic fittings designed to simplify assembly and allow newcomers to practice model-building techniques such as dry-fitting, gluing and basic painting. The kit is suitable for a first-time ship model project and for educational use where understanding parts layout and ship structure is required.
The starter kit is designed for ease of use, with parts sized and finished to reduce the need for advanced tools or extensive preparation. Components are organized to guide assembly sequence and to help users learn standard modelling steps. The set supports practice in handling adhesives, aligning hull sections and applying simple paint layers, which helps develop steady-hand skills and familiarity with ship model terminology and parts.
Carefully remove parts from sprues and identify components according to the included instructions. Test-fit parts before applying adhesive to ensure correct alignment. Apply modelling glue in small amounts to bond hull sections, superstructure and fittings; allow each joint to cure before proceeding. After assembly, clean any seam lines with a hobby knife or fine sandpaper, then apply primer if desired and paint using thin, even coats. Follow safety guidance when using adhesives, paints and cutting tools.
Use the kit with basic modelling tools: sprue cutters, hobby knife, fine sandpaper, model glue and small brushes. Work in a well-ventilated area and wear protective gloves or a mask if using solvent-based paints or adhesives. Allow adequate drying time between steps to achieve a cleaner finish and improved fit.
